Islamabad: In line with the guidance of Noor Ul Amin Mengal, the Chairman of the Capital Development Authority (CDA), proactive measures are being implemented against illegal car showrooms operating in various sectors and commercial zones throughout Islamabad.
Enforcement operations were conducted on Thursday to address the issue of unauthorized car showrooms. These operations were executed by teams from the Building Control, Estate, and Enforcement wings. Notably, over 100 illegal car showrooms were effectively closed down in the G-8 sector.
It is worth mentioning that a considerable number of complaints had been lodged concerning these unlawful establishments, with a focal point being the G-8 area. The principal objective behind Chairman Noor Ul Amin Mengal’s directive to shut down these showrooms is to foster legitimate business activities while concurrently ensuring unhindered pedestrian movement.
Moreover, a specialized operation initiated on Tuesday has resulted in the closure of more than 130 unlicensed car showrooms. This concerted effort primarily concentrated on key areas including F-10, F-11, the Blue Area, and G-8.
It is of significance to underscore that these unauthorized car showrooms not only infringed upon public parking spaces but also impeded the convenience of pedestrians. In addition, Chairman Noor Ul Amin Mengal, through an extensive advertising campaign, had forewarned property owners against deploying their premises for illicit activities. Non-compliance with this directive could potentially lead to the confiscation or sale of such properties.
Following the elapse of the stipulated deadline set by the CDA, as well as the issuance of multiple notifications, a comprehensive survey was conducted. This involved compiling a comprehensive list of all unlicensed car showrooms across diverse centers. Subsequently, actions were initiated in accordance with established protocols. These measures will remain in effect until all illegal car showrooms are effectively eradicated.
